From: https://ldrs37.org/fliers-spectators/

Motor Limits

NOTE: This is a commercial launch only. The State of California regulations prevents us from flying research motors within the state. Maximum Impulse limits for California are listed below:

Maximum Impulse per rocket motor – 10,240 Ns “M”
Maximum combined total impulse (Complex rocket) – shall not exceed 20,2480 Ns “N”​

Hmmmmmmm, Isn't it also (unfortunately) leave yer' Loki motors at home territory?
Should make that clear to the unfamiliar if that's still true. Ashame too. Kurt
 
Hmmmmmmm, Isn't it also (unfortunately) leave yer' Loki motors at home territory?
Should make that clear to the unfamiliar if that's still true. Ashame too. Kurt

Correct - Loki motors have not been submitted to the Calif State Fire Marshal for 'Classification', and are thus not allowed.
